Situated within the vibrant Highland village of Appin, the property enjoys a convenient location between the principal towns of Oban and Fort William. Appin offers a strong sense of community and a range of local amenities, including a highly regarded primary school, churches, restaurant, garage, garden centre, and active village hall. Additional facilities can be found in neighbouring Port Appin, including an excellent village store with post office, doctor’s surgery, and welcoming hotels. The area is renowned for its natural beauty and outdoor lifestyle. Nearby attractions include the iconic and widely photographed Castle Stalker and newly opened café, The Linnhe, both just a short drive away. Residents and visitors alike can enjoy a wealth of leisure pursuits, from water activities on Loch Linnhe and scenic cycling routes through the village to golf at the highly regarded nine-hole course in nearby Ballachulish.
